Understanding the Tempur Material
At the heart of the "is Tempur the best mattress" debate is the proprietary foam used in the construction. Originally developed by NASA to cushion astronauts during launch, this viscoelastic foam is designed to respond to both body heat and weight. Unlike standard memory foam that can feel firm until it eventually warms up, Tempur material reacts instantly to body heat and sinks deeply, creating a unique cradle-like effect. This specific formulation is intended to reduce motion transfer significantly, meaning that if your partner moves during the night, you are far less likely to feel it.
The Feel and Support Profile
The feel of a Tempur mattress is frequently described as firm yet enveloping. Because the foam is dense, it provides a robust base that prevents the feeling of sinking too deeply without the support you need for your spine. For side sleepers, this is particularly beneficial, as the foam compresses at the shoulder and hip, alleviating pressure points that might cause pain on a less adaptive surface. Back and stomach sleepers often find that the mattress offers sufficient resistance to keep the body from sagging, maintaining a neutral spine position throughout the night.
Comparing to Traditional Options
To determine if Tempur is the best choice, it is essential to compare it directly with traditional innerspring or hybrid mattresses. Innerspring models rely on coils for support, which can create pressure points on the shoulders and hips where the body does not align with the grid. Hybrid mattresses attempt to bridge the gap with foam layers over coils, but they often lack the singular, cohesive feel of the Tempur design. The consistency of the foam across the entire sleeping surface minimizes disturbances and creates a unified sleeping environment that is difficult to replicate with other constructions.
Motion Isolation: Superior to most competitors due to the foam's ability to absorb movement.
Pressure Relief: Excellent for those suffering from joint pain or arthritis.
Temperature Regulation: Historically a challenge for memory foam, though recent models incorporate cooling technologies.
Durability: High-density foam tends to retain its structure for many years without developing body impressions.
Considerations and Potential Drawbacks
Despite the numerous advantages, the "best" mattress is inherently subjective, and Tempur may not be the ideal solution for everyone. One common consideration is the initial odor, often referred to as off-gassing, which can be strong when the mattress is first unpacked. While the smell typically dissipates within a few days, individuals with sensitivities or respiratory issues may find this initial phase uncomfortable. Furthermore, the classic Tempur feel is distinct; some sleepers who prefer a bouncier or more traditional firm mattress might find the material too soft or confining, particularly in the early weeks of adjustment.
Temperature and Lifestyle Factors
Historically, memory foam has been criticized for trapping heat, but Tempur has addressed this concern in modern iterations. Many of their current models feature open-cell structures or gel infusions that promote airflow and draw heat away from the body. If you tend to sleep hot, looking for a model within the TEMPUR-Adapt or TEMPUR-Cloud line that specifically mentions cooling properties is advisable. The ability to regulate temperature plays a crucial role in the overall quality of sleep, impacting how restful and uninterrupted the night becomes.
